"My Super Silly Snake Sandwich"

What you'll need:
1 cheese slice
4 crackers
4 apples slices
2 grapes
Directions
Cut the cheese into 4 pieces. Lay down a cracker, a piece of cheese, and an apple slice. Repeat the pattern until you use up all the crackers, cheese and apples. Add a grape for a head and tail.

Dirt Pudding

Chocolate pudding
Banana slices
chopped nuts
graham cracker crumbs
gummy snakes (OK you may call them gummy worms!)
  1. First you put some pudding in a cup.
  2. Add banana slices and nuts.
  3. Fill with more pudding.
  4. Put one or two gummy snakes (OK- worms!) into the pudding.
  5. Top with graham crackers crumbs and nuts.

     

    Scouts Egg-Stravaganza in Toast

    Depending on your cookie cutters, this can be anything you want . . . eggs in a boat, eggs in a heart. You will need

     

    A slice of bread
    2 tablespoons of butter
    One egg
    Spatula and a small frypan
    Favorite cookie cutters and a grown up to help with the stove.

     

    1. Take a piece of bread and cut a hole in the center with your favorite cookie cutter -- you can even use an upside down glass.
    2. Melt one tablespoon of butter in a small frying pan over a low heat. Add the bread to the pan and then break the egg into the hole. Cook until the bread is golden on the other side.
    3. Turn the bread over, add the rest of the butter and keep frying until the egg looks done- just a couple of minutes more.
